
Principal's Hour is one of the great highlights of the week at Sydney Missionary and Bible College. Students and staff, along with the worldwide SMBC online family, gather to hear a Bible talk as well as prayers, engaging interviews and dives into cultural engagement. The show blends Bible talks with interviews and cultural discussions, anchored in a Bible college community. Across episodes, guests share practical ministry insights, cross-cultural experience, and reflections on leadership, unity, and discipleship, often tying scriptural themes to contemporary life. Notable strengths include a strong emphasis on community, theological depth accessible to students and lay listeners, and a steady cadence of guest voices that explore hospitality, mission, and leadership within diverse contexts.
